Pretty Woman

  • But Rahab the prostitute and her father's household and all who belonged to her, Joshua saved alive. And she has lived in Israel to this day, because she hid the messengers whom Joshua sent to spy out Jericho. Joshua 6:25 ESV

    The least of the least, Rahab was always looked down on by the other women of the city. She was a prostitute, covered in shame with no hope, and no future. She exchanged sex for food to simply keep her and her family alive. When she trusted in the Lord and hid the spies that Joshua sent, she was brought into the Lord's family and became the great, great grandmother of King David. She is also listed in the lineage of Jesus Christ (Matt 1:15).

    One of the most anointed women that I ever saw preach was a former prostitute. Almost from the time she started speaking, demons started screaming and coming out of people in the church. She said that when she first gave her life to Christ and was delivered of crack and many other things, no normal Christians would help her. Instead, she converted some of her street walking friends and started a ministry. Now God is powerfully using them to deliver people from very bad things.

    No matter what you have done, no matter where you are, God has a place for you in His family. You have not wrecked your life and it can be redeemed. There is still hope. It is not too late. He will take you and use your life to reach others that are where you used to be. Start today by praying for Him to make what is important to Him, important to you.
